Description
- 5230 HAMBLE HIGH STREET (north side)
Manor Farm SU 4806 NW 10/122
II GV
- Early C19 house, with plain street front, but complex prominent side elevations. Three storeys, 2 windows to front, coved eaves, second floor band (forming cills), bracketted first floor cills, plinth. Sashes, in reveals. West side door has heavy simple pediment on brackets and plain architrave. Side elevation has 2 small arched windows to second floor on either side of massive 2-storeyed bay (of 3 windows), beyond is elaborately formed chimney, with steps, arched opening above square recess. Beyond is a red brick outbuilding with red tile roof and massive chimney to front gable.
